Title: National Emission Standards for Hazardous Air Pollutants: Shipbuilding and Ship Repair (Surface Coating) Operations--Amendment 
Abstract: On December 15, 1995, the EPA issued national emission standards for hazardous air pollutants (NESHAP) under section 112 of the Clean Air Act for shipbuilding and ship repair (surface coating) operations. The NESHAP requires existing and new major sources to control emissions of hazardous air pollutants to the extent achievable by the use of maximum achievable control technology. This action is intended to more clearly state the distinction between and the definition of ship and pleasure craft. It is being issued in response to questions concerning whether yachts greater than 20 meters (78.7 feet) in length are ships and, therefore subject to the NESHAP or pleasure craft. This proposed action will ensure that all activities such as pleasure vessels (yachts) intended to be subject to the NESHAP are in fact subject to it.

Timetable:
Action Date FR Cite
NPRM  12/29/2006  71 FR 78392   
Direct Final Action  12/29/2006  71 FR 78369   
Withdrawal of Direct Final  02/27/2007  72 FR 8630   
Reproposal  12/00/2008    
Final Action  01/00/2010
